MANNERS & MORALS: Americana, Sep. 1, 1947

Notes on U.S. customs, habits, manners & morals:

¶ U.S. Army headquarters in Rome announced that pregnancy was no longer a reason for marriage. Reasons: 1) too many "undesirable" Italian girls were using it as a means of getting to the altar with a G.I., and thus to the U.S., 2) too many occupation troops were too young to recognize a scheming woman.
